And now, come to help me, an orphan. Put in my mouth persuasive words in the presence of the lion and turn his heart to hatred for our enemy, so that he and those who are in league with him may perish. Save us from the hand of our enemies; turn our mourning into gladness and our sorrows into wholeness.” Esther C:23-25

Women in the Bible are fighters, and they take no prisoners because sometimes, the enemy will only stop when you stop their beating hearts.

For three days, she lay prostrate in prayer while covered in dirt and ashes as she sought the will of God, then she rose up and did what she had to do, putting herself in harm’s way to save Mordecai and her people.

This is how Haman came to be hanged on the gibbet he had built for Mordecai.

Subject yourself to the Lord, and your mourning will be turned into gladness.
